The Final Chapter in the Book of VENOM by Donny Cates & Ryan Stegman! This is it, Venomaniacs! The landmark 200th issue starring the most sinister symbiote in the Marvel Universe arrives - and after this, NOTHING WILL BE THE SAME! From Donny Cates, Ryan Stegman, and a who's who of artists from the issues that tore Eddie Brock's life asunder and brought the KING IN BLACK to Earth, comes the first chapter of the rest of Venom's life. But in Knull's wake, what even remains of the Lethal Protector? Rated T+

New release comics are received, carefully bagged and boarded, and shipped directly to you. We handle every book with care and do our best to send you copies in the best shape possible.

That said, **we cannot guarantee Mint (9.8) condition on any book.** Printing and bindery imperfections are part of the industry - not every copy off the press qualifies as a 9.8, and we have no way to guarantee which copy you'll receive.

Our new releases are generally **Near Mint (NM 9.4 or better)** unless otherwise noted. Common allowable defects at NM include:

- Minor spine dings or stress marks
- Slight cover wear from handling or shelving
- Printing artifacts (color rubs, paper waviness from the press)
- Small bindery offsets, especially on cardstock covers
